1- Can you help me defend the solution Cisco FireSIGHT Management Center. My company is planning to acquire two ASA5515-FPWR (for failover) to deploy at Internet Edge. I suggest the acquisition in addition of Cisco FMC Appliance. But I have to give the advantages, knowing that we can also manage ASA FirePOWER services with ASDM!
2- Can you explain me the licensing process for FirePOWER Services. Is the license ordering process different when you use Cisco FCM to manage FirePOWER on ASA ?

If you have the choice between management with ASDM and through FPMC (which can also run virtually on ESXi), choose FPMC as that is much more powerful then the management through ASDM. When you manage via ASDM , you can see only real time connection events . Using an FMC you can get the full view of connection events and based on the database settings you can decide how much events you want to store.
